HOME | Definition of energetic (ENERGETIC, Energetic)


    Energetic \En`er*get"ic\, Energetical \En`er*get"ic*al\, a. [Gr.
    ?, fr. ? to work, be active, fr. ? active. See Energy.]
    1. Having energy or energies; possessing a capacity for
    vigorous action or for exerting force; active. "A Being
    eternally energetic." --Grew.
    [1913 Webster]

    2. Exhibiting energy; operating with force, vigor, and
    effect; forcible; powerful; efficacious; as, energetic
    measures; energetic laws.

    Syn: Forcible; powerful; efficacious; potent; vigorous;
    effective; strenuous. --

    energetic
    adj 1: possessing or exerting or displaying energy; "an energetic
    fund raiser for the college"; "an energetic group of
    hikers" [ant: lethargic]
    2: working hard to promote an enterprise [syn: gumptious, industrious,
    up-and-coming]
